Austin Butler and Matt Smith were spotted in some pretty colorful outfits on the set of their new movie Caught Stealing on Monday.

Butler, 33, and Smith, 41, were spotted on the New York City set on Monday, alongside director Darren Aronofsky.

Earlier this month, Butler was seen kissing his co-star Zoe Kravitz as production continued in the Big Apple.

While filming on Monday, Butler was seen wearing a turquoise dress shirt with dark gray jeans and black Puma sneakers.

He was also wearing a black coat and was also seen filming scenes inside a primered gray car with Smith on Monday.

Butler also took a break while sitting on camera at one point between takes of the adaptation of Charlie Huston’s 2005 novel of the same name.

However, Smith sported a very different look, highlighted by the colorful yellow and maroon mohawk on his head.

He was also wearing a drab gray coat with marks all over it, underneath a black t-shirt with ripped flannel jeans and black combat boots.

Between takes, Smith wore a red and black flannel sweater while chatting with co-star Butler in their chairs on set.

They were filming at Flushing Meadows-Corona Park in Queens, with the iconic Unisphere structure (created for the 1964 World’s Fair) in the background.

One of the shots they were filming involved Butler and Smith running away from their gray car for some reason.

The film follows a former baseball player named Hank Thompson (Butler), who finds himself embroiled in the criminal underbelly of New York City in the 1990s.

Smith joined the cast in August, although it is unclear which character he will play in the film.

The cast also includes Liev Schreiber, Griffin Dunne, Vincent D’Onofrio, Regina King and Bad Bunny.

Aronofsky will direct from an adapted script written by author Huston himself, with Aronofsky producing with Jeremy Dawson, Dylan Golden and Ari Handel.

Sony Pictures will distribute the film, although there is no indication of when it is scheduled for release.

Butler comes from Dune: Part Two and Masters of the Air, while Smith comes from season 2 of HBO’s House of the Dragon.
